Selecting the Best Cuts
When it comes to including grass-fed meat right into your culinary creations, a vital element to think about is choosing the very best cuts to make certain optimum flavor and tenderness in your recipes. Grass-fed meat supplies an one-of-a-kind preference profile and dietary advantages, but the selection of the appropriate cuts can even more improve the overall eating experience.
When choosing grass-fed meat cuts, focus on those with greater marbling as this indicates even more flavor and tenderness as a result of the existence of healthy and balanced fats. Cuts like ribeye, tenderloin, and New york city strip steaks are popular selections known for their rich marbling and delicious appearance. Constance Cattle. In addition, cuts from the shoulder or chuck area, such as chuck roast or shoulder steak, can be flavorful choices for slow food preparation approaches like braising or stewing

Furthermore, think about the food preparation technique you intend to utilize when picking grass-fed meat cuts. Some cuts are preferable for grilling or pan-searing, while others beam when roasted or simmered gradually. By recognizing the attributes of different cuts and matching them with proper cooking methods, you can boost the taste and inflammation of your grass-fed meat recipes.

Cooking Methods for Optimal Flavor
To elevate the flavors established with spices and marinading methods, the option of cooking techniques plays an essential role in her comment is here bringing out the optimal taste of grass-fed meat dishes. When cooking grass-fed meat, it is essential to consider methods that boost the all-natural inflammation and abundant flavor of the meat while ensuring it remains tasty and juicy.
Barbecuing is a prominent cooking method for grass-fed meat as it conveys a great smoky charred flavor that complements the meat's all-natural sweet taste. Scorching the meat in a hot pan or frying pan is an additional exceptional method to secure the juices and develop a savory crust externally. Sluggish cooking approaches such as braising or cooking are optimal for tougher cuts of grass-fed meat, permitting them to become tender and savory over time.
Additionally, toasting grass-fed meat in the oven at a modest temperature level can aid caramelize the exterior while maintaining the indoor juicy. Experimenting with various food preparation techniques based upon the cut of meat can enhance the total dining experience and guarantee you appreciate the complete potential of grass-fed meat's remarkable preference.
